Вводная МаксМногосайт
Четверг, 14 мая 2009 г.
Рубрика: Сайтостроительство
Метки: cms | maxsite
Подписаться на комментарии по RSS
Рубрика: Сайтостроительство
Метки: cms | maxsite
Подписаться на комментарии по RSS
Приветствую друзья!
Вот наконец дошли руки собрать воедино то, о чём я давно уже рассказывал. А именно многосайтовую модификацию для MaxSite CMS. В следующей заметке будет дана ссылка на скачивание, а сейчас хочу рассказать о некоторых особенностях модификации.
- Первое, оно же главное: всё сделано в наиболее упрощённом виде. Как уже говорил, для того, чтобы обновления самой системы, по возможности, не затрагивали модификацию.
- Второе: небольшое количество файлов в скачанном архиве. Следует из первого пункта. Разброс по папкам для наиболее простой установки. Вы просто копируете файлы в корень сайта и наслаждаетесь эффектом.
- Третье: в файлах по паре строк добавленного кода. Истина в простоте ;-) Действительно, всё очень просто!
Из недостатков:
- База данных засоряется! Многовато записей, дублируется кое-что. Да и не уверен что даже 20+ сайтов оно потянет... хотя кто знает?
- Изменены файлы плагина xml-sitemap. Теперь карта сайта расположена не в корне, а в шаблоне. Соответственно права на запись надо выставить вручную...
- Общий доступ к upload
- Общие ушки. Даже не знаю недостаток ли...
- Распаковываем на сервер MaxSite CMS
- Качаем самый новый архив с модификацией.
- Распаковываем в корень сайта с заменой существующих файлов.
- Прописываем логин-пароль к базе в соответствующем файле. (application\config\database.php)
- Берём нужный шаблон для сайта. Папку переименовываем так: наш сайт site.ru, папка site_ru
- В папку копируем sitemap.xml. Ставим права на запись.
Оставьте комментарий!